Key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ent by June 2026
  • High school GPA 2.5 or above
  • Academic math GPA 2.5 or above
  • English GPA 2.5 or above
  • Biology and Chemistry GPA 2.5 or above
  • Less than 30 college credits
  • At least 18 years of age by August 1, 2026
  • Less than 2 years of related work experience
